Output e973b46b2a928d682271e78c3ed82d5b4c93ea6761b1bbceb1477226856bd896:3

value
25213362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d73cae4b56e939e96ff4b2a064f13205f7422b OP_EQUAL
address
34EE1ev2dmzbcGddXLS1Dbkwy7DxszdQSt
transaction
e973b46b2a928d682271e78c3ed82d5b4c93ea6761b1bbceb1477226856bd896
confirmations
304424
spent
true